Brian Keenan died earlier this week, aged 70
The chief minister has added to the many tributes paid to the man known as 'Mr Empress'.
Brian Keenan, who has died at the age of 70, was general manager of the hotel on Douglas promenade for some three decades.
He was a popular and well-known figure to tourists and locals alike.
